Defense Strategies Institute’s (DSI’s) inaugural MOSA for Defense Summit will provide a forum for members of the DoD, military services, industry, academia, and other key stakeholders to discuss the warfighting imperative of implementing a modular open systems approach (MOSA) in the design, development, delivery, acquisition, and sustainment of modern warfighting systems.

Specific topics to be discussed include:

  • Acquiring Interoperable and Adaptable Defense Systems that Evolve to Joint Force Mission Needs
  • Testing the Future:  DOT&E Insights on MOSA Implementation in Defense Systems
  • Engineering the Future:  Advancing Defense Capabilities Through MOSA
  • The Role of Consortiums in Developing and Maintaining Open Standards for Government and Industry Technologies
  • Driving Standardized Approaches to Promote Efficiency, Cost-Effectiveness, and Interoperability Across Defense Systems and Technologies
